Understanding Car Title Loan Minimum Payment Requirements
When considering a car title loan, understanding the minimum payment requirements is crucial for managing your finances effectively. Lenders typically set these minimums based on factors like the loan amount, interest rates, and the duration of the loan. The goal is to ensure borrowers can make consistent payments without defaulting. In many cases, car title loans offer more flexible repayment terms compared to traditional loans, allowing you to spread out your payments over a period that suits your budget. This can provide much-needed relief when facing unexpected expenses or urgent financial needs, also known as emergency funding.
The minimum payment amounts for car title loans vary from lender to lender and state to state. Some lenders may require daily or weekly payments, while others offer more extended repayment periods. It’s essential to carefully review the loan terms and conditions before signing any agreements. By understanding these requirements early on, you can plan accordingly and avoid potential penalties or fees associated with late or missed payments. Factors Influencing Loan Duration for Car Title Loans
The duration of a car title loan is influenced by several key factors, including the loan amount sought, interest rates offered by lenders, and the borrower’s ability to make consistent minimum payments. Lenders typically calculate repayment terms based on a structured schedule, where borrowers repay a fixed amount each month over a predetermined period. For instance, a smaller loan with a lower interest rate might be structured for faster repayment, while larger loans may have longer durations to spread out costs.
Another factor that plays a role is the borrower’s credit history and overall financial health. Lenders often consider bad credit loans as higher-risk ventures, which can result in slightly shorter loan durations or stricter minimum payment requirements.
